## Onboarding: Kestrel Cache Postmortem

New on-call engineers should read the Kestrel stale-cache postmortem first. Short version: invalidation messages were dropped silently, so menus served hours-old data. The fix added a reconciliation sweep every ten minutes. If the sweep alert fires, run the manual flush script, which authenticates to the internal cache API with the key below.

API key for tagug-tajef: vxb4-R1fo

**Q: How do assistants arrange bike cage and parking gate access for visitors?**

The bike cage at Ferrow House opens from 06:30 to 20:00 on working days. Parking gate requests must be logged a full day ahead via the Gatekeeper form, including plate details and expected duration. Once approved, admit the visitor yourself using the pass code below.

staff pass of kawip-hawef = bdg-QLP-2

Finance Review Summary — Loyalty Programme Overhaul

For sales leads. The Bramblepoint loyalty scheme overhaul is costed at 820k over two years. Redemption liabilities fall 18% under the new tier structure; breakage assumptions verified by Finance. Migration of existing members begins next quarter, with legacy points honoured for twelve months. Expect short-term friction at till level; scripts will be issued. Budget sign-off is expected imminently. The commercial reasoning behind the redesign is summarised in the confidential note below.

management briefing: Silethax Systems plans to raise the Holix list price by 50.2 percent in December. The steering committee signed off on a budget of $329.9 million for Project Holok. The renewal with Juldorax Foods closes at $278.2 million a year, 54.3 percent above the last contract. Project Briir slips by one quarter because of the supplier delay.